PHP Класс App\Services\Html\FormBuilder

Наследование: extends Collective\Html\FormBuilder
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
category ( $subject, $type, array $options = [] ) : string
checkboxWithLabel ( $subject, string $fieldName, string $label, array $options = [] ) : string
closeButton ( ) : string
datePicker ( string $name, string $value ) : string
getLabelForTranslatedField ( string $fieldName, string $label, string $locale ) : string
locales ( array $locales, string $current ) : string
media ( $subject, string $collection, string $type, $associated = [] ) : string
openButton ( array $formOptions = [], array $buttonOptions = [] ) : string
openDraftable ( array $options, Model $subject ) : string
redactor ( $subject, string $fieldName, string $locale = '', array $options = [] ) : string
tags ( $subject, string $type, array $options = [] ) : string
useInitialValue ( $subject, string $propertyName, string $locale = '' ) : string

Защищенные методы

Метод Описание
getAssociatedMediaData ( $associated = [] ) : string

Описание методов

category() публичный Метод

public category ( $subject, $type, array $options = [] ) : string
$options array
Результат string

checkboxWithLabel() публичный Метод

public checkboxWithLabel ( $subject, string $fieldName, string $label, array $options = [] ) : string
$fieldName string
$label string
$options array
Результат string

closeButton() публичный Метод

public closeButton ( ) : string
Результат string

datePicker() публичный Метод

public datePicker ( string $name, string $value ) : string
$name string
$value string
Результат string

getAssociatedMediaData() защищенный Метод

protected getAssociatedMediaData ( $associated = [] ) : string
Результат string

getLabelForTranslatedField() публичный Метод

public getLabelForTranslatedField ( string $fieldName, string $label, string $locale ) : string
$fieldName string
$label string
$locale string
Результат string

locales() публичный Метод

public locales ( array $locales, string $current ) : string
$locales array
$current string
Результат string

media() публичный Метод

public media ( $subject, string $collection, string $type, $associated = [] ) : string
$collection string
$type string
Результат string

openButton() публичный Метод

public openButton ( array $formOptions = [], array $buttonOptions = [] ) : string
$formOptions array
$buttonOptions array
Результат string

openDraftable() публичный Метод

public openDraftable ( array $options, Model $subject ) : string
$options array
$subject Illuminate\Database\Eloquent\Model
Результат string

redactor() публичный Метод

public redactor ( $subject, string $fieldName, string $locale = '', array $options = [] ) : string
$fieldName string
$locale string
$options array
Результат string

tags() публичный Метод

public tags ( $subject, string $type, array $options = [] ) : string
$type string
$options array
Результат string

useInitialValue() публичный Метод

public useInitialValue ( $subject, string $propertyName, string $locale = '' ) : string
$propertyName string
$locale string
Результат string